About This Book

Ivy: Yankee Sweetheart, Rebel Nurse is set during the Civil War and is the story of Ivy Rowland who falls in love with and is betrothed to Seth Wommack, a handsome Union Army cavalry officer. When her betrothed goes off to war, Ivy becomes a nurse in the Confederate Army, and her father joins the rebel Corps. Ivy's father is killed during the war and Ivy believes that her betrothed has also been killed in a battle. She then enters into a "conditional" marriage with Joseph Morgan, a young man who has fallen in love with Ivy, and who will fight for the Confederacy. Her story takes a surprise turn when her betrothed re-enters her life. Ivy: Camp Branch to Groveton is a sequel to Ivy: Yankee Sweetheart, Rebel Nurse. The sequel explores the relationships between Ivy Rowland, Seth Wommack, and Joseph Morgan and the effects of war on these relationships.
